The Cable Capers
Think of your HDMI cables as tiny messengers, carrying video and sound. If one of these messengers gets jostled, the sound can vanish faster than a donut at a police convention.

Try unplugging and replugging the HDMI cables connecting your TV to your cable box, DVD player, or game console. Make sure they're snugly fit into their ports.
Power Cycle Ponderings
Consider this: your TV is basically a giant, sophisticated computer. And like any computer, sometimes it just needs a good old-fashioned reboot. We all know that feeling!

Unplug your Vizio TV from the wall outlet for a full minute. This forces it to reset completely. Plug it back in, and cross your fingers – you might just be back in business.
The "Software Glitch Gremlins"
Just like your phone, your TV has software that needs updating. Outdated software can cause all sorts of funky problems, including… you guessed it, disappearing sound!
Navigate to your Vizio TV's settings menu and look for the "System" or "About" section. There should be an option to check for software updates. Keep your TV up-to-date.

The Sound Bar Saga
Many folks use a sound bar to boost their TV's audio. It's a great way to get more immersive sound, but it also introduces another point of potential failure.
If you're using a sound bar, make sure it's properly connected and turned on. Check the sound bar's volume and input settings, too.
